Smallmouth BassTechniqueDrop ShotSeasonSpring (Pre-Spawn)StructureRock PileThe bite was slow. Fish were holding in 5-6 foot of water outside of current breaks. Some were also caught on a DT 4 and ned rig. It was a very enjoyable day. The weather was great and spring is upon us. The fishing should only get better.

Smallmouth BassTechniqueNed RigsSeasonSpring (Pre-Spawn)StructureBrush PilesWith a freeze warning from the night heading into the day, the smallies were slow moving. The fish were in 4-8 fow. Out side of current seams with boulders. Slow moving ned rigs or drop shot was key to getting the fish to commit. The water level was 5.5 on the river gauge. The water was also slightly stained. I added scent to my plastic.

Smallmouth BassTechniqueStructure JigsSeasonSpring (Pre-Spawn)StructureFlooded BrushWas targeting smallmouth but ended up with a few largemouth in the river. Did catch some smallmouth on the smaller side. Was casting towards the laydowns on the bank and slowly crawling the sleeper craw back with a few hops. Largemouth were just sucking the craw in. very subtle bite. 12lb invisx line and using a 7'3" alpha angler zilla rod.

Smallmouth BassTechniqueTubesSeasonSpring (Pre-Spawn)StructureRock PileAmazing day of fishing and catching smallmouth ranging in size from 3 to 5 pounds! Water was high and muddy, so fish were hanging tight to the bank. But, they proved to be willing biters for most of the day.

Smallmouth BassTechniqueShallow Diving Crankbaits (0-6')SeasonSpring (Pre-Spawn)StructureBouldersThe slow bite using ned rigs and tubes was not working. I sped it up cranking hard against the current in feeder creeks. It started producing steadily
